The Met Office is warning about flooding later tonight.
An amber warning says slight to moderate flooding can be expected between 12.30am and 4am.
The following areas are thought to be most at risk:
- The Tongue, North Quay and Lake Road in Douglas
- Mezeron corner, West Quay and Parliament Street in Ramsey
- Castletown promenade, Back Hope Street, Victoria Road and the Qualtroughs Timber Yard
- Laxey promenade and Tent Road
A severe gale force wind warning remains in force across the Island.
